This book is the perfect combination of a full read and a book of short stories. You will enjoy the adventures of growing up on the lower Tongue River in Northern Wyoming. The author, Kenn Pilch was born and raised on the four thousand acre ranch and with his older brother and sister, worked as a part of the family trying to make things profitable. In these short stories, he shares his memories of the hard times, the fun times the loving times and the aggravating times. By the end of this book, you will have met his family, some of the animals he grew up with and feel like you were there as he experienced these events. Mary Sunshine, the sheep that had it in for him, Petals, the milk cow that just wouldn't cooperate and Snoop, the horse that hit him, all come alive as you read these twenty stories. Kenn wasn't a perfect child and much of life he had to learn on his own. Now in his retirement years, he shares with us the sometimes funny, sometimes frightening and sometimes dangerous stories as he remembers them. He truly lived each story. He was there when Daisie, the geriatric cow stumbled through the roof of the tunnel he and his brother dug. You will feel the moisture from a fresh rain on your pant legs as you witness his dad save the neighbors cow. Kenn gives us a front row seat to learn how Biddy the old setting hen reluctantly gives her all to the families favorite meal of chicken and noodles. Each story will take you there to the ranch as you walk along side Kenn as he does his chores, gets repeatedly taken down by a mean old sheep and ends up in the river while chasing Petals the cow. It is a wild rodeo as Kenn shares the giant mishap of his horse being pulled over backwards in the corral of calves with him still in the saddle. Volume 1 and this book, volume 2 give you a total of 36 wonderful stories to stir your feelings of what life was like as a ranch hand on the Tongue River in Northern Wyoming.
